Free Crochet Princess Crown Pattern.   by Regina Deemer

Every girl deserves to feel like a princess especially on their birthday, so I decided to crochet a birthday crown.  Playing dress up is what little girls like to do.  They love to wear pretty dresses, high heels,  getting into their mom’s makeup  and trying on all kinds of hats, especially crowns.  For this crochet crown I decided to use a chunky yarn.  I love the look of the yarn and it works up quick.  You must use the yarn in the directions.  If you do not use the yarn recommended in the directions, your crown will flop and not stand up.  If you would like to use a thinner yarn I recommend using a cotton yarn and a crochet hook the yarn calls for.  For a stiffer crown use a spray starch and and place your crown on a foam head, cap drying rack or something similar and let stand to dry.  Have fun and I hope you enjoy making this pattern as much as I did.

To Crochet the Chunky Princess Crown

Materials: 

  • 1 ball Lion Brand Hometown USA in – Providence Pink  / Color A
  • 1 ball Lion Brand Hometown USA in – Dallas Grey  / Color B
  • 1 ball any shiny yarn (Optional) I used a shiny pinkish. I purchased this around Christmas.
  • Crochet hook – K
  • Scissors

Abbreviations:

  •  ch – Chain
  •  C – Crochet
  • sc – Single Crochet
  • yo – Yarn Over
  • w/ – With
  • st – Stitch
  • sl st – Slip Stitch
  • hdc – Half Double Crochet
  • dc- Double Crochet
  • dc pc – Double Crochet Popcorn
  • dc sh – Double Crochet Shell
  • tc sh – Treble (Triple) Crochet Shell

Special Instructions: 

Shell – 5 dc, or what ever stitch the directions call for, in the same st. to do this you start with a dc – Yarn over, insert hook into stitch, yo pull hook out of stitch, yo pull through 2 loops on the hook, yo pull through 2 more loops on hook. Dc made. Make 4 more dc’s in the same st. Shell made.

dc Popcorn – To do this you must first make 5 dc in the same stitch. (See shell directions above) Next you take the hook out of the last dc made and insert the hook into the first dc made and then into the last dc made. Pull the last dc through the 1st dc. dc popcorn made.

dc sh – To do this see directions for the shell.

tc sh – To do this you must first make 5 tc in the same st. tc – yo hook twice then insert hook into the st, yo, pull hook out of st, yo pull through 2 loops on hook, yo pull through 2 loops on hook, yo pull through 2 more loops on hook. Do this 3 times, 1 tc made. Now make 4 more tc in the same st.

Directions:

R. 1 –  W/ color A. ch 50, sl st to the beginning. ch 2. (50)

R. 2  hdc in the back bump of the 2nd ch and in ea ch around. sl st in the top of the ch 2. ch up 2. (50)

R. 3 – hdc in ea st around to end. sl st in the top of the ch 2. (50)

R. 4 – hdc in the next 4 sts. You can add the new color for the popcorn in the next st or keep using the same color. I will be using the new color for the popcorn balls. Attach new color, color B and dc popcorn in the next st, (1st popcorn made) W/ color A and  hdc in th next 7 sts,  W/ color B,  dc popcorn in the next st, (2nd popcorn made) W/ color A  hdc in the next 7 sts. W/ color B dc popcorn in the next st, (3rd popcorn made)  W/ color A,   hdc in the next 7 sts, W/ color B dc popcorn in the next st, (4th popcorn made) W/ color A  hdc in the next 7 sts. W/ color B dc popcorn in the next st, (5th popcorn made) W/ color A,  hdc in the next 7 sts, W/ color B dc popcorn in the next st, (6th popcorn made) W/ color A  hdc in the next 5 sts. sl st to the top of the ch 2.   (6 popcorns made)

R. 5 – W/ color B, ch up 2 (counts as 1 dc) and dc popcorn. W/ color A,  dc in the next 3 sts. Dc sh in the top middle of the popcorn,  dc in the next 3 sts. W/ color B dc popcorn in the next st. W/ color A, dc in the next 3 sts, dc sh in the next st, dc in the next 3 sts. With color B dc popcorn in the next st. W/ color A, dc in the next 3 sts, dc sh in the top of the popcorn. dc in the next 3  sts. W/ color B dc  popcorn  in the next st. W/ color A, dc in the next 3 sts, dc sh at the top of the popcorn. dc in the next 3 sts. W/ color B Dc popcorn in the next st. W/ color A, dc in the next 3 sts, dc sh in the popcorn, dc in the next 3 st. W/ color B dc popcorn in the next st. W/ color A  and dc in the next 3 sts, dc sh in the next st, dc in the next 3 sts. Join at the top of the popcorn. Fasten off color B, you will use color A for the next  row.

R. 6 – W/ color A ch 1, sc in the next 3 sts, hdc in the next st, dc in the next, ch 1, sk next  st,  tc sh in the next st, ch 1,  sk the next 2 sts, dc in the next st, hdc in the next st, sc in the next 6 sts, hdc in the next st, dc in the next st, ch 1 sk 1 st, tc sh in the next st, ch 1 sk the next  st, dc in the next st, hdc in the next st, sc in the next 6 sts, hdc in the next st, dc in the next st, ch 1, sk the next  st, tc sh in the next st, ch 1, sk next  st, dc in next st, hdc in the next st, sc in the next 6 sts, hdc in the next st,dc in the next, ch 1, sk next  st, tc sh in next st, ch 1, sk 1 st and dc in the next st hdc in the next st, sc in the next 6 sts, hdc in the next st, dc in the next, ch 1, sk 1 st, tc sh in the  next st, ch 1, sk the next  st, dc in the next, hdc in the next, sc in the next 6 sts, hdc in the next, dc in the next, ch 1 sk 1 st, tc sh in the next st, ch 1 sk next  st, dc in next st, hdc in next st, sc in the next  st,. Join w/ a sl st in the ch 1 sp. Fasten off and weave in ends.

R. 7- Optional. You can attach the shiny yarn or omit this part. Attach shiny yarn and sc in the next 6 sts, ch 1, sk the next st, sc in the next,  dc popcorn,   sc in the next 2 sts, ch 1, sk 1, sc in the next 9 sts, (ch 1, sk the next st, sc in the next st, dc popcorn in next st, sc in the next 2, ch 1 sk 1, sc in the next 9sts). Repeat what’s in the parenthesis around to the end, sl st to join, fasten off, leave enough to weave ends.
